Animal Products (Regulated Control Scheme—Dairy Export Quota Products) Regulations 2008. Country/Territory New Zealand Document type Regulation Date 2008 Source FAO, FAOLEX Subject Food & nutrition Keyword Milk/dairy products Food quality control/food safety International trade Processing/handling Offences/penalties Geographical area Asia and the Pacific, Australia and New Zealand, Oceania, South Pacific Entry into force notes These Regulations enter into force on 1 July 2008. Abstract These Regulations impose a regulated control scheme in respect of dairy products destined for export to dairy quota markets in order to control and manage the processing of dairy material and products and to meet any applicable designated market access requirements.
